Working Hours

Mon - Sat: 10 AM-7:30 PM

For Appointment


What’s Cloud Elasticity? +how Does It Affect Cloud Spend?

While scalability involves expanding sources to satisfy rising demand, elasticity handles the fluctuations in that demand, fine-tuning useful resource allocation in real time. You want instruments that work with this need for flexibility and offer dynamic solutions catering to modern businesses’ elastic needs. Business course of management options corresponding to Wrike make fluctuating workloads a breeze, due to features like automated workload balancing and real-time project changes. Our platform’s ability to combine with cloud providers means you’ll have the ability to fully leverage elasticity, optimize assets, and maintain costs in verify. In contrast, cloud scalability is the deliberate capacity planning and resource allocation for anticipated development, making certain a system can handle increased loads over time.

scalability vs elasticity in cloud computing

Automating scaling actions within cloud platforms like DigitalOcean, AWS, and Google Cloud reduces the executive overhead for IT departments. Rather than manually predicting and adjusting for utilization spikes, these cloud providers can improve or lower resources in response to real-time demand. This shift away from guide intervention permits IT personnel to concentrate on strategic initiatives somewhat than the trivialities of capability planning. Understanding the similarities and variations between scalability and elasticity can lead to more practical decision-making and resource allocation, ultimately optimizing your cloud computing techniques.

Cloud Elasticity And Cloud Spend

This includes making certain that information is protected both in transit and at rest and that the dynamic nature of useful resource allocation does not introduce new vulnerabilities. To harness the true energy of cloud computing, it’s crucial to know what Scalability and Elasticity mean and the way they differ from one another. This article will clarify both concepts in-depth, focus on their important impression on cloud computing, and supply helpful insights on choosing between them. In the case of needing extra processing power, a company strikes from a smaller resource to a bigger one that is extra performant, corresponding to moving from a virtual server with two cores to at least one that has three. While cloud scaling is automated and quick, usually on the order of seconds for brand spanking new containers and up to minutes for VMs, to convey up new hardware can take some time. Vertical Scalability (Scale-up) –In this type of scalability, we enhance the ability of existing assets in the working surroundings in an upward direction.

This scalability may be achieved by manually increasing the sources or through automation with self-service instruments that allow for scalability on demand. In cloud computing, scalability and elasticity are two important ideas that need to be understood to make the most of the capabilities of this expertise effectively. Scalability and elasticity are usually used interchangeably — and wrongfully so. While they could sound related, each are completely different from one another by means of overall fashion and approach.

It provides tools that enhance workflows, encourage collaboration, and elevate productiveness. Features for real-time communication and intuitive task management ensure your group is aligned and efficient. Imagine computational energy not caught in distant information facilities but distributed right the place the action is, slashing delays and supercharging response instances. This combo of edge computing and elasticity might redefine efficiency standards across the board. The initial funding is important, as scalable methods usually require intensive hardware and infrastructure. This can pose a challenge, especially for smaller organizations or those with tight budget constraints.

scalability vs elasticity in cloud computing

DigitalOcean excels in this space by offering a set of merchandise designed to help you scale your operations smoothly and effectively. Cloud scalability offers companies with the flexibleness to discover new markets and adjust to adjustments of their industry without being constrained by their IT infrastructure. As alternatives come up, a scalable cloud setting may be shortly adjusted to help new functions or increased workloads. This means corporations can respond to market tendencies and buyer needs with agility, maintaining them forward of opponents.

Threat Management

With cloud computing, you probably can adjust compute assets to meet altering demands. For instance, you ought to buy extra on-line storage on your chatbot system as you receive growing buyer inquiries over time. Thanks to the pay-per-use pricing model of recent cloud platforms, cloud elasticity is a cost-effective answer for companies with a dynamic workload like streaming services or e-commerce marketplaces. Online gaming platforms can expertise sudden surges in user exercise, particularly throughout new recreation releases, special occasions, or aggressive gaming tournaments. Cloud elasticity allows these platforms to allocate further assets to deal with the increased load, ensuring seamless gameplay and minimal latency. As the event concludes or the initial rush subsides, the allocated sources can be reduced to prevent incurring prices from idle sources.

Overall, Cloud Scalability covers expected and predictable workload calls for and handles rapid and unpredictable modifications in operation scale. The pay-as-you-expand pricing mannequin makes the preparation of the infrastructure and its spending budget in the long run without too much strain. The evolution of applied sciences performs a pivotal role in enhancing scalability and elasticity. Additionally, methods like multi-cloud adoption have been highlighted as effective ways to spice up these elements, lowering prices and increasing efficiency. Typically, scalability is a long-term solution best fitted to businesses with steady, linear progress.

Since elasticity typically leverages the cloud to scale assets flexibly, it’s essential to keep an eye on the prices that can accumulate. It’s additionally important to make sure these bills fit inside your budget without inflicting financial pressure. In resume, Scalability gives you the flexibility to extend or lower your resources, and elasticity lets these operations happen routinely according to configured guidelines. Leverage the power of easy-to-use, scalable Droplets, Managed Kubernetes, and sturdy cloud storage options to effortlessly develop your digital infrastructure. Begin with DigitalOcean today and scale with confidence, figuring out your cloud setting is equipped for fulfillment at every stage of your business growth. A workload, in the context of IT and cloud tech, is a system’s task amount of computational work.

The firm’s objective is to create lasting value all through the complete digital transformation journey. Our 4,000+ engineers and specialists are well-versed in 100s of applied sciences. As an autonomous, full-service growth firm, The App Solutions specializes in crafting distinctive merchandise that align with the specific aims and rules of startup and tech companies. The versatility is completely relying upon the climate as now and again it’d turn out to be unfavorable characteristic where execution of certain applications most likely ensured execution. Agbaje Feyisayo is a dynamic content material marketing skilled boasting over 10 years of experience in product advertising.

  • Elasticity provides the performance to mechanically increase or lower resources to adapt dynamically primarily based on the workload’s calls for.
  • When we talk about scalability, we’re talking about the capacity of your cloud services to grow with you.
  • Vertical scalability, or scaling up or down, refers to adding more energy (like CPU, RAM) to an present machine or replacing one with a extra powerful one.
  • This approach is particularly efficient in distributed methods the place workloads can be easily partitioned across multiple machines.
  • Scalability tackles the increasing demands for assets, within the predetermined confines of its allocated assets.

After that, you can return the additional capability to your cloud supplier and hold what’s workable in everyday operations. Three wonderful examples of cloud elasticity at work embody e-commerce, insurance, and streaming services. Additionally, scaling this way permits systems to be easily expanded or contracted as wanted, while not having to exchange current scalability vs elasticity in cloud computing hardware or applications. The scaling happens on the software program level, not necessarily on the hardware stage. This information will explain what cloud elasticity is, why and the means it differs from scalability, and how elasticity is used. We’ll also cowl specific examples and use instances, the benefits and limitations of cloud elasticity, and how elasticity impacts your cloud spend.

Predicted Developments In Elasticity

Where IT managers are keen to pay just for the length to which they consumed the resources. With Wrike’s generative AI and Work Intelligence® resolution, you handle and keep ahead of tasks. Wrike is designed to adapt to your project’s wants, ensuring scalability and elasticity always work in your favor. Ensuring the infrastructure is appropriately arrange and maintained demands experience and sources. Both, Scalability and Elasticity refer to the flexibility of a system to grow and shrink in capacity and assets and to this extent are effectively one and the identical. Scalability is usually guide, predictive and planned for expected situations.

scalability vs elasticity in cloud computing

These volatile ebbs and flows of workload require flexible useful resource management to handle the operation consistently. It turns out to be useful when the system is predicted to experience sudden spikes of person activity and, as a result, a drastic enhance in workload demand. Maintaining a constant security posture and compliance with laws may be challenging as assets are dynamically allotted and unallocated. Each new digital machine or storage instance introduced to satisfy demand have to be configured to adjust to the organization’s security policies.

Scalability is the deliberate, strategic adjustment of sources to fulfill the projected calls for of development or shrinkage over time. It’s concerning the system’s functionality to scale up or down smoothly in response to anticipated long-term changes, ensuring sustained efficiency and price effectivity. While both scalability and elasticity pertain to useful resource management in cloud computing, they operate differently. Scalability measures a system’s capability to handle increased load by scaling up (vertical scalability) or out (horizontal scalability). Cloud scalability is the capability of a cloud computing surroundings to effectively handle growing or diminishing workloads by proportionally adjusting its useful resource footprint.

scalability vs elasticity in cloud computing

Scalability is largely handbook, deliberate, and predictive, while elasticity is automatic, immediate, and reactive to expected circumstances and preconfigured guidelines. Both are essentially the identical, besides that they happen in several conditions. The versatility is important for mission basic or business basic functions the place any cut up the difference in the exhibition may prompts enormous business misfortune. Thus, flexibility comes into image the place extra assets are provisioned for such application to fulfill the presentation stipulations. It’s not just about having the know-how; it’s about orchestrating it smartly.

This elasticity ensures that your team can reply to changes swiftly, maintaining high efficiency and meeting deadlines, even when dealing with unexpected challenges. Elasticity is a system’s knack for adjusting its resource ranges routinely to match the workloads it faces at any second. This sensible adaptation ensures sources are well spent during quiet durations and manageable throughout spikes in demand. Fully harnessing elasticity’s potential requires implementing predictive analytics and advanced monitoring to auto-scale assets. Microsoft Azure’s Autoscale for automated useful resource changes and AWS Lambda for serverless computing are examples of instruments to help with this.

scalability vs elasticity in cloud computing

An elastic cloud system routinely expands or shrinks to have the ability to most closely match sources to your needs. Cloud scalability is not hampered by a company’s bodily hardware sources. Whereas the bodily nature of hardware made scaling a slower course of, in the cloud, scalability is far more efficient and effective. Scaling your sources is the primary big step towards bettering your system’s or application’s efficiency, and it’s necessary to grasp the distinction between the two main scaling varieties. Learn more about vertical vs. horizontal scaling and which must be used when. Business could be unpredictable, and demand can skyrocket overnight or fluctuate seasonally.